大数据流程通常包括数据采集、数据存储、数据处理、数据分析和数据展示等环节。这些流程可以大致分为以下几个关键步骤:
1. 数据采集(Data Collection)
- 确定数据源,比如传感器、日志文件、网页、社交媒体等。
- 设计数据采集方案,选择合适的采集工具和技术,如APIs、爬虫、网络抓取等。
- 实施数据采集,确保数据的质量和完整性。
2. 数据存储(Data Storage)
- 根据数据类型和处理需求选择合适的存储技术,如Hadoop HDFS、NoSQL数据库、关系型数据库等。
- 设计数据存储架构,确保数据的可扩展性和容错性。
- 实现数据的存储和管理,包括数据的备份、恢复和监控。
3. 数据处理(Data Processing)
- 对原始数据进行清洗和预处理,去除噪声和无关信息,提高数据质量。
- 使用ETL(提取、转换、加载)工具或编写脚本进行数据抽取、转换和加载。
- 利用数据挖掘、机器学习等技术进行数据分析,发现数据中的模式和趋势。
4. 数据分析(Data Analysis)
- 应用统计分析、描述性统计、预测性建模等方法对数据进行分析。
- 探索数据中的潜在关联和规律,为决策提供依据。
- 可视化分析结果,如使用图表、仪表盘等工具展示分析结果。
5. 数据展示(Data Visualization)
- 将分析结果以直观的方式呈现,如报表、图表、仪表盘等。
- 通过数据可视化工具帮助决策者理解数据,做出更好的决策。
6. 数据安全与合规(Data Security and Compliance)
- 确保数据在采集、存储、处理和展示过程中的安全性,防止数据泄露和滥用。
- 遵守相关法律法规,如GDPR、HIPAA等,保护个人隐私和敏感信息。
7. 数据治理(Data Governance)
- 建立数据治理框架,明确数据所有权、访问权限和数据质量管理标准。
- 定期审查和更新数据治理策略,确保数据流程的持续改进和优化。
8. 持续学习与优化(Continuous Learning and Optimization)
- 随着技术的发展和新数据的产生,不断学习和更新数据采集、存储、处理和分析的技术和方法。
- 优化数据流程,提高效率和准确性,减少资源浪费。
总之,大数据流程是一个复杂的系统工程,需要跨学科的知识和技术,以及严谨的规划和执行。通过对数据采集、存储、处理、分析和展示等环节的精细化管理,可以实现对大数据的有效利用,为企业决策、创新和竞争优势提供有力支持。